Bristol 4th of July Parade 2024: The Bristol Fourth of July Parade is a beloved annual event that has been held in Bristol, Rhode Island since 1785. It is the oldest continuous Independence Day parade in the United States, and is a cherished tradition for residents and visitors alike. One common question that is often asked about the parade is: how long is it?

The answer to this question is that the Bristol 4th of July Parade is quite long, typically lasting for several hours. The parade route is approximately two and a half miles long, and the parade itself can take anywhere from two to four hours to complete, depending on the number of participants and the pace of the parade.

The parade features a wide range of participants, including marching bands, floats, military units, fire trucks, and community groups. It is estimated that there are over 100 different groups that participate in the parade each year, with thousands of people marching and cheering along the route.

In addition to the parade itself, there are also many other events and activities that take place on the 4th of July in Bristol. These include a fireworks display, a concert, and various other festivities and celebrations throughout the day. Many people make a full day of it, arriving early to secure a good spot along the parade route and staying late to enjoy all that the day has to offer.
